Transaction 66a1af493eec7cd773359ff9028e2ee7b13030f448a8794d6be8943ac8c2634b
1 Input
1 Output
-
66a1af493eec7cd773359ff9028e2ee7b13030f448a8794d6be8943ac8c2634b:0
- value
- 321717163
- script pubkey
- OP_0 OP_PUSHBYTES_20 261652847c7b8c45b49d543664f5eadbfd570411
- address
- bc1qyct99pru0wxytdya2smxfa02m074wpq3z4msng